Dictionary: lis·some  lis·som (lĭs'əm) pronunciation
 
also adj.
  1. Easily bent; supple.
  2. Having the ability to move with ease; limber.

[Alteration of LITHESOME.]

lissomely lis'some·ly adv.
lissomeness lis'some·ness n.

The adjective has one meaning:

Meaning #1: gracefully slender; moving and bending with ease
  Synonyms: lissome, lithe, lithesome, slender, supple, svelte, sylphlike
